Использование Response.BinaryWrite при нажатии кнопки - PullRequest
1 голос
/ 26 июля 2011

У меня есть событие нажатия кнопки, и в нем я вызываю этот метод для создания PDF. Это работает нормально при первом нажатии на кнопку, но не работает, если я снова нажимаю на кнопку, чтобы выполнить операцию снова. Спасибо.

 private void CreatePDF(Customer c)
    {
        Response.ClearHeaders();
        Response.ClearContent();
        Response.ContentType = "application/pdf";
        Response.AddHeader("content-disposition", "attachment; filename=test.pdf;");
        Response.BinaryWrite(GetPrintableCustomer(c));
        Response.End();
    }
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...